KELMO Posted October 19, 2017 Report Share Posted October 19, 2017 Door lock knob grommet 80970-A4600 80970-21001 The "A4600" should be the newest part #. May or may not still be available through Nissan. 1 Quote Link to comment

datsunfreak Posted October 21, 2017 Report Share Posted October 21, 2017 And I have a question for you 510 experts.. Do the solid metal door handles just go on the rear doors, or were they ever used on the front doors, too? Just the rears, and only on wagons. The '68 model had them on all 4, but a slightly different shape. And MUCH cooler grab handles. Those wagon rears also use a special "gasket" between the handle and door panel not used on anything else. 1 Quote Link to comment
